Field Studies Council is an environmental education charity. Founded in 1943, we are best known for providing residential and day field trips for those studying biology and geography. But our mission is to create outstanding opportunities for everyone to learn about nature.
We do this through fieldwork and outdoor learning courses for schools, colleges and universities:
-Primary school trips offering first-hand adventures in nature, from day visits to first overnight stays and activity-packed residentials.
-Secondary school and college courses tailored to your particular curriculum requirements or syllabus, with relevant practicals and fieldwork content.
-University fieldtrips where students come to our centres for their research and fieldwork.
Field Studies Council has a network of UK residential and day centres, and a range of places in which to learn. Find out more about our locations below.
